How to prepare for a job interview at TeacherActive
✨Know Your EYFS
Make sure you brush up on the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) framework. Being able to discuss how you implement EYFS principles in your practice will show that you’re not just familiar with it, but that you can apply it effectively in a nursery setting.
✨Show Your Caring Nature
During the interview, share specific examples of how you've supported children's development in previous roles. Highlight your nurturing approach and how you create a safe and stimulating environment for children to thrive.
✨Flexibility is Key
Since the role values flexibility, be prepared to discuss your experiences working across different age groups and rooms. Share how you adapt your teaching style to meet the needs of various children, showcasing your versatility.
✨Teamwork Makes the Dream Work
Emphasise your communication and teamwork skills. Talk about how you’ve collaborated with colleagues and families in the past to enhance children's learning experiences. This will demonstrate that you’re a team player who values collaboration in a nursery setting.
